Senior Business Analyst / Delivery Manager, Trinny London, GB

Job Description

Are you ready to rethink your routine? We’re looking for a Senior BA / Delivery Manager to join our Tech team. Reporting to our Head of Portfolio & Delivery, you will be responsible for defining and delivering high-impact initiatives that directly support our ambitious growth targets. This is a critical dual-role position where you'll act as the crucial link between business stakeholders and our tech team, playing a pivotal role in projects that have a direct impact on cost savings, revenue growth, and the streamlining of our business operations, particularly for our Operations, Supply/Demand, Planning, Finance & Data/BI departments.



Welcome to Trinny London!

Here at Trinny London, we’re changing the face of makeup and demystifying skincare, and we're only just getting started. Founded in 2017 by Trinny Woodall, Trinny London is challenging people all over the world to rethink their routines.

We have achieved tremendous growth since 2017 and we’re proud to be one of Europe’s fastest-growing beauty brands. We’re generating millions of sales by developing innovative products, acquiring hundreds of thousands of supporters and customers all over the world, and more importantly, building a talented and motivated team to support our fantastic growth.

Our Values


We live by three core values: we bring fearless passion, we act with smart intent and we all wear yellow.

We always go the extra mile, working together to push boundaries and celebrate our wins and learnings as a team. We listen to every idea, big or small, and make considered decisions. We support each other to achieve our goals and thrive on collaboration.

The Role 

Your daily to-dos might look like this:

  • Engage with stakeholders to elicit, analyse, and document business requirements, processes, and systems.
  • Lead workshops, interviews, and stakeholder discussions to uncover needs and clarify scope.
  • Translate business requirements into clear user stories, acceptance criteria, and process flows.
  • Facilitate documenting Solution Designs
  • Ensure all tech team requests are consistently captured and documented in Jira, meeting the "definition of ready."
  • Guarantee that all technical deliveries meet the Definition of Done.
  • Perform gap analysis, impact assessments, and feasibility studies to support decision-making.
  • Support Product Owner(s) and business stakeholders in prioritising initiatives, features and enhancements.
  • Collaborate with offshore technical teams to ensure requirements are feasible and aligned with architecture and design.
  • Own delivery planning, ensuring initiatives are well-defined, resourced, and tracked to completion.
  • Develop and maintain delivery roadmaps, timelines, and sprint/release plans.
  • Monitor progress, manage risks/issues/dependencies, and escalate when necessary.
  • Ensure projects are delivered on time, within scope, and aligned to business objectives.
  • Manage stakeholder expectations, providing clear communication and status reporting, including with third-party suppliers.
  • Drive continuous improvement in our delivery practices, tools, and team effectiveness.
AI-Powered Job Matching

Get personalized insights and tailored applications with our AI tools:

AI Match Scoring

Get your exact compatibility score for each job based on your CV and experience

CV Tailoring

Automatically optimize your CV for each specific job application

Gap Analysis

Identify missing skills and get actionable improvement recommendations

Start Free Today

No credit card required • 100% free to start

Get Your Personal Job Feed

Join thousands of professionals getting AI-powered job recommendations tailored to their skills.

Daily job alerts matching your profile
AI match scores for every job
One-click CV tailoring
Application tracking
Get Started Free

Frequently Asked Questions about Senior Business Analyst / Delivery Manager Jobs in GB